Portrait of a Young Man

Portrait of a Young Man by Fulchran Jean Harriet

Medium

Black chalk, stumped, heightened with white. Framing line in pen and brown ink.

Dimensions

15 1/8 x 14 13/16 in. (38.4 x 37.7 cm) Diameter of circle containing portrait: 30.2 cm

Classification

Drawings

Department

Drawings and Prints

Museum

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York, NY

Credit

Harry G. Sperling Fund, 1984

Accession Number

1984.322
